Following the Cook Islands' announcement to enter into a partnership with China, New Zealand has decided to suspend financial aid, including a planned payment of nearly €10 million for development. The New Zealand government, which has allocated some €100 million over the past three years, has called for concrete measures from the Cook Islands to restore confidence. The move reflects concerns about China's growing influence in the resource-rich Pacific.
